Part 1: Decoding Smart Wear
The term ‘smart wear’ in fashion parlance signifies a dress code that’s chic, classy, and slightly formal. It’s about striking an ideal equilibrium between casual and formal attire.
Subpart 1.1: Constituents of Smart Wear
The spectrum of smart wear encompasses diverse clothing pieces. Staples like suits, blazers, dress shirts, chinos, and dress shoes are common elements. Accessories such as ties, cufflinks, and pocket squares can accentuate your smart wear appeal.
Part 2: The Indispensable Pieces of Smart Wear
To curate a multifaceted smart wear closet, certain staple pieces are indispensable for every man.
Subpart 2.1: The Suit
A suit that fits like a glove is the bedrock of any smart wardrobe. Opt for hues like navy, charcoal grey or black for optimal flexibility.
Subpart 2.2: The Blazer
A blazer renders a slightly casual alternative to a suit jacket while maintaining a refined appearance. Stick to classic shades like navy or black, or venture out with patterns or audacious colours.
Subpart 2.3: The Dress Shirt
An immaculate dress shirt is a fundamental component of smart wear. White and light blue remain classic options, but don’t shy away from experimenting with patterns.
Part 3: Styling Your Smart Wear
The art of styling your smart wear is as crucial as owning the right attire.
Subpart 3.1: Combining Pieces
Combining smart wear pieces is all about harmony. Pair a bold blazer with a minimalist dress shirt, or let a patterned tie become the focal point against a neutral suit.
Subpart 3.2: Accessorizing
Accessories can infuse a personal touch into your smart wear ensemble. Select a tie that harmonizes with your suit and shirt, and remember cufflinks and pocket squares.
Part 4: Preserving Your Smart Wear
Appropriate maintenance will keep your smart wear in pristine condition and prolong its life.
Subpart 4.1: Cleaning
Most smart wear items should be dry-cleaned to maintain their shape and fabric quality. Always refer to the care label before cleaning.
Subpart 4.2: Storage
Store suits and blazers on hangers to keep their shape intact, and neatly fold dress shirts in a drawer.
